User:lucyajei271841

From myWiki
Jump to navigation Jump to search

Looking to boost your online presence? Delhi NCR is a hub for digital marketing agencies, each offering a unique range of services. Whether you need search engine optimization, social media

https://pennyeldb249676.blog-gold.com/46392838/leading-digital-marketing-agencies-in-delhi-ncr

Retrieved from ‘https://wikiannouncing.com